Branch County chooses new administrator

A Jackson County native has been chosen to serve as Branch County administrator.

Frank Walsh, who most recently worked as Meridian Township manager in Ingham County, will replace 18-year veteran Bud Norman, who has retired.

Walsh’s previous experience includes administrative roles in the communities of St. Joseph and Cedar Springs.

He was chosen from a field of three candidates who interviewed for the county post. County officials said Walsh is expected to start in November.
